Partner anti theft alarm issue

Hey, I've got a 2020 electric Peugeot Partner with 136288 km. Recently the anti-theft alarm has gone wonky. Getting an error in the memory, and the alarm itself doesn't seem to be working. Any ideas? I've heard something about optical locking being the issue.

leatiger12 (Author)

Thanks for the advice! Took it to a workshop, and you were right; the alarm system was coded to activate the optical locking, which was causing the errors. They recoded it, and it's fixed now. Cost me 45€.
